XRA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review
34 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Exeter Resources Corporation (XRA)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$53.1M — up 174% from $19.4M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 14 funds opened new XRA posit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 10 added to existing stakes and 3 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Sun Valley Gold, adding an estimated $2.95M. The largest seller was Global X Management Company, cutting an estimated $2.23M.
